How Prostate Cancer is Diagnosed
Diagnostics for prostate cancer are aimed at determining the stage and spread of the tumor which is especially important for stage 4 prostate cancer. Doctors first assess the patient's overall oncological status to determine the optimal treatment.
The main methods include:
PET-CT with PSMA to detect metastases in bones, lymph nodes and internal organs
Multiparametric MRI of the prostate to assess the local spread of the tumor
Fusion biopsy which provides high-precision tissue samples for morphological analysis.
PSA and other laboratory markers that reflect the activity of the tumor process.
In complex cases, genetic tests are used to help select personalized prostate cancer therapy and predict the response to radionuclide treatment (Actinium225, Lutetium-177). This approach provides the most accurate diagnosis for patients from abroad.

Innovative Advanced Prostate Cancer Therapy
Clinics in Germany use several groups of high-tech methods aimed at controlling the primary focus and metastases. The main areas include:
Interventional radiology (minimally invasive tumor control):
Thermoablation — destruction of the tumor with high temperature
Cryoablation — freezing and destruction of tumor cells
Electrochemotherapy (ECT) — local administration of the drug with electroporation amplification
Prostatic artery embolization (PAE):
Blocking the blood supply to the tumor through embolization of the arteries
Reducing the size of the affected tissue and controlling symptoms
Suitable for patients with large tumors or concomitant prostatic hyperplasia
Dendritic cell immunotherapy for prostate cancer:
Stimulation of the body's own immune system to recognize and destroy tumor cells
Especially relevant in metastatic prostate cancer, when a long-term immune response is important
Forms a stable antitumor response
Radionuclide therapy (Actinium-225 and Lutetium-177):
Targeted delivery of radioactive particles to the tumor through specific receptors
Actinium-225 has a powerful cytotoxic effect on micrometastases
Lutetium-177 helps control the spread of metastases
